This Webinar
Delivering any project within the agreed upon time, cost, and quality constraints is always very important and challenging. But stakes may be even higher for Utility Company projects because they often have a significant impact on people’s well-being.
This session will focus on how to establish realistic estimates and schedules that support business objectives and meet client expectations.
Benefits of this Webinar
This webinar will help participants to improve their abilities to:
- Leverage the most appropriate tools and techniques for establishing realistic schedules and cost estimates in typical Utility Company environments
- Manage unique challenges faced by Utility Project Managers, e.g., multi-year Project Life Cycles, procurement of equipment with a long delivery time, lengthy licensing and permitting phases, etc.
- Choose the most efficient type of contract for a specific project
- Use the baseline and additional tools and techniques to effectively control project performance for Utility Companies
What You Will Learn
- How to use the work breakdown structure (WBS) as the basis for effective resourcing, estimating, and scheduling on projects
- To estimate durations and costs using a variety of techniques
- To develop sound preliminary schedules using the critical path method and implement their effective adjustments
- To establish realistic schedule and cost baselines, with appropriate risk plans
- To use earned value management (EVM) to manage time and cost performance
